Over the past 24 years, there have been 21 property sales recorded in the LE2 9RG postcode area. The highest sale price reached £230,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ced house sold in April 2023 for £191,954.
The estimated average property value in LE2 9RG currently stands at £196,767, which is approximately 37.9%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£2,302.
Property prices in LE2 9RG have risen by 1.6% over the past year , with a total increase of 32.9%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 84.2%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is terraced, making up around 95% of transactions , followed by semi-detached.
Housing in LE2 9RG is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 55% of homes being lived in by the owners.
